B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, exclusively formulated for feed-quality use and examined to meet stringent quality and basic safety specifications. BHT is really a lipophilic organic compound that may be generally applied as an antioxidant in various industrial programs. In animal nutrition, BHT FEED GRADE TEST is greatly made use of to forestall the oxidation of fats and oils in animal feed, thus preserving the nutritional value and lengthening the shelf life of the feed. Oxidized fats not only lose nutritional efficacy but also can generate destructive compounds, influencing the well being and progress of livestock. The inclusion of BHT in feed involves arduous screening to be sure it adheres to regulatory expectations and is particularly Safe and sound for usage by animals, which sooner or later enters the human food stuff chain. The tests protocols commonly evaluate the purity, efficacy, and possible residues in animal tissues.

Yet another significant compound while in the chemical domain is Pentachloropyridine. This compound is a chlorinated by-product of pyridine and it has garnered desire due to its utility being an intermediate inside the synthesis of agrochemicals, dyes, and prescribed drugs. Its substantial diploma of chlorination causes it to be a potent compound, which ought to be handled with care due to potential toxicity and environmental problems. Pentachloropyridine serves for a creating block in chemical synthesis, allowing chemists to acquire additional elaborate molecules That could be Utilized in herbicides, insecticides, as well as specialty polymers. The dealing with and disposal of Pentachloropyridine are regulated, supplied its potential environmental persistence and bioaccumulation chance. Industries dealing with this compound typically adopt closed-system generation solutions and arduous security protocols to minimize exposure.

M-Phenylene Diamine, usually abbreviated as MPD, is surely an aromatic amine that attributes prominently inside the production of aramid fibers, which can be perfectly-known for their heat resistance and power. Kevlar and Nomex, used in entire body armor and fireplace-resistant garments, respectively, are generated employing MPD to be a essential precursor. The compound by itself includes a benzene ring with two amino teams from the meta positions, which makes it ideal for creating polymers with fascinating thermal and mechanical Qualities. M-Phenylene Diamine (MPD) is usually Employed in the dye market, especially in hair dyes and also other cosmetic apps, Though its use is curtailed in certain areas on account of security considerations. When manufacturing products made up of MPD, proper occupational security procedures are important to guard staff from prolonged exposure, which could lead to pores and skin sensitization or other health concerns.

O-Phenylene Diamine (OPDA), even though structurally much like MPD, differs inside the positioning in the amino teams, which substantially influences its chemical reactivity and application. OPDA is often used during the manufacture of dyes and pigments, exactly where it contributes towards the formation of vivid hues which have been secure and extensive-lasting. It is usually used in the synthesis of heterocyclic compounds and prescription drugs. OPDA’s position in corrosion inhibitors and rubber chemicals further highlights its flexibility. Having said that, similar to other aromatic amines, OPDA is also linked to toxicity challenges, and therefore, its use is thoroughly managed and monitored. The necessity of correct managing, proper storage, and enough protecting steps can not be overstated when handling OPDA in almost any industrial environment.

Pinacolone is yet another noteworthy compound with a range of apps. This is a ketone While using the molecular formulation C6H12O and is also applied primarily being an intermediate during the synthesis of pesticides and herbicides, particularly while in the production of triazole fungicides and certain plant growth regulators. Pinacolone’s construction includes a tertiary butyl team, which contributes to its distinctive reactivity in natural synthesis. Past agriculture, it can even be found in the manufacture of pharmaceuticals and fragrances. Pinacolone is valued for its capacity to undergo nucleophilic substitution and condensation reactions, rendering it a useful reagent in laboratory and industrial procedures. Although it's significantly less hazardous than some of the Earlier reviewed compounds, protection precautions are still important to mitigate any challenges linked to its volatility and likely irritant properties.

two-Heptanone is a ketone that Normally happens in certain vegetation and can also be located in tiny portions in human sweat and particular animal secretions. It is often Utilized in the fragrance and flavor industries due to its nice, fruity odor. In addition, 2-Heptanone has uncovered programs like a solvent and intermediate in organic and natural synthesis. Curiously, analysis has proposed that it could Perform a job in chemical signaling, specially in insects, in which it acts as an alarm pheromone. This has brought about its examine in pest Manage tactics and behavioral science. Industrially, two-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its fairly reduced toxicity makes it well suited for use in purchaser products, While suitable labeling and handling instructions are normally mandated.
